Title :
Modelling of conduction process in dielectric liquids
Author :
Dikarev, B. ; Karasev, G. ; Romanets, R.
Author_Institution :
Dept. of Phys., Prydniprovs´´ka State Acad. of Civil Eng. & Archit., Dnipropetrovsk, Ukraine
Abstract :
On the basis of the experiments on conduction in dielectric liquids the mathematical model of conduction of these liquids is developed. The obtained system of quasilinear differential equations were computed by the method of the finite differences. The theoretical simulation gives a good agreement with the results of experimental investigation of conduction process in carbon tetrachloride.
